2. Connect modem with the controller
The input and output interfaces of the modem are shown in Figure 2.12.
Figure 2.12 Input & output interfaces of TD-5648DCII Modem
1) Connect a telephone line to the 'LINE' interface on the modem.
2) Use a power cable to connect the positive and negative power terminals (silkscreen: POWER) of the modem to the
DC positive busbar and negative busbar (below the battery fuse) of the power system respectively.
3) Use a communication cable to connect the communication interface of the modem (DB25 female, silkscreen: RS-232)
to the J6 interface (DB9 male) of the controller.
NOTE! During system testing, set the parameter 'Modem' of the controller to 'Y'.
Connecting dry contacts
The controller provides five pairs of dry contacts, which are J6 and J7 interfaces shown in Figure 2.10. Peel one end of
the signal cable (optional) and insert it into J6 and J7 interfaces. The functions of the dry contacts are given in Table 2.5.
Table 2.5 Dry contact functions
Interface
Function
J6-1, 2, 3
AC mains failure
J6-4, 5, 6
DC over/undervoltage
J6-7, 8, 9
Rectifier and MPPT module failure
Note: The above functions are default settings. Users can change them through the controller
